About Pentwater, MI
Pentwater is a small community in Michigan with a population of 885 residents. The median household income is $76,688 per year, which is above the national average. The median age in Pentwater is 65.4 years.
Housing in Pentwater has a median home value of $347,200 and median monthly rent of $540. Of the 1,041 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 365 owner-occupied and 72 renter-occupied units.
The unemployment rate in Pentwater is 7.6% and the poverty rate is 11.4%. 55.6%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 18.9 minutes.

Cost of Living in Pentwater, MI
Compared to national averages, Pentwater has a median household income of $76,688 (2% above the national median of $75,149). Home values average $347,200, which is 42% above the national median. Monthly rent at $540 is 54% below the US average of $1,163. Within Michigan, Pentwater's income is 16% above the state average of $66,017, and home values are 89% above the state median of $183,391.
